Output 31fcb77ecfc0d481226b870feffe69543920ffb373567e9f28b111be898915df:1

value
9290383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b41a15ebbe408c8242d61b0f09a18c817b6897 OP_EQUAL
address
35QEhv6C7ZUJsZ8zyBFUWKSEtG2DahJKU2
transaction
31fcb77ecfc0d481226b870feffe69543920ffb373567e9f28b111be898915df
spent
true